To be fair, I think Reptile was indeed much worse pre-patch. Prior to the August patch, all his claw moves were unsafe, his pounce was unsafe, his invisibility was not plus, his f2 was negative on hit, forceballs had even more startup (I think 37 frames), acid spit was 5% damage so he lost all trades, he couldnt combo off ex slide, and none of the nimble combos involving spit worked.

I wouldn't put him in the category of characters who weren't changed much and were good all along. Those are huge.

I'm going to have to disagree. I forgot to mention that in a previous patch, Reptile also got his 7 frame d3 (his fastest poke used to be 9 frames) and a bunch of damage buffs (his bnbs which currently do low 30s now used to do even less). So to recap, Reptile had no safe specials to build meter or blow up fuzzy guards with, no safe anti-zoning moves, some of the lowest damage in the game, no plus frames to speak of (everything off his f4 string is -5 or worse, even now ... his only actual plus frames are off st 1 and st 2, which are 10 and 12 frame highs with very little range), one projectile that started up in 37 frames, a high projectile that started up in 17 frames yet tied with cyber kano for least damaging projectiles in the game, and a 9 frame poke. He also could not make use of the option select as far as I know. These were the tools he had to compete with the likes of pre-patch Raiden, KL, Tanya, Shinnok, Liu, Cage, Erron, etc. There is no way pre-patch Reptile can be considered good relative to the nonsense in the game at the time. I would say easily bottom 10, at a time when the gap between top and bottom tiers was much wider. Milky performed amazingly well but Reptile was genuinely - dare I say - abysmal at launch.

All fair points but I think looking at only his frames is not really ideal, for example his fastest poke might have been slow but don't forget he's always had a 9 frame mid in F4 which is his main stagger string. His F21 has great range and F2 is only 13f with very good reach. You can make virtually any character look bad by just listing frame data.

Also while the force balls were slow you have to take into account what he gets once they're on screen, they allow him to command a lot more space and he's always had his safe 50/50s and correct me if I'm wrong but hasn't his B2 launcher always been plus on block?

Granted when you compare him to some of the other dumb shit at that time he doesn't look like much but calling him abysmal is a stretch for me.
